Grønne træer – cushion – Søren Nielsen (SN)
"Green Trees" is an embroidered cushion in which Søren Nielsen — known from BALDYRE — works with the forms of nature in a clear, rhythmic expression. The motif consists of a collection of deciduous trees, each with its own character and crown shape, rendered in a uniform green colour palette. The trees stand freely across the surface, together forming a lively yet balanced pattern.
The composition is surface-covering and built through repetition. The individual trees vary in density and structure, creating a calm movement across the cushion. The pattern has no fixed orientation, allowing the cushion to work visually from all sides and maintain its expression regardless of placement.
The colour scheme is simple and cohesive. Green tones dominate, giving the motif freshness and clarity. Variation arises through the stitching and the construction of the trees rather than through changes in colour. Danish Flower Thread supports this with its matte surface and clear colour depth, giving the embroidery life without appearing heavy.
Linen 10B serves as a calm and natural base. The fabric’s texture contrasts with the dense stitching and highlights the trees’ graphic silhouettes. The interplay between thread and linen gives the cushion a classic Nordic character with a clear sense of craftsmanship.
